Navigating low energy availability and bone stress injury back to running 100 miles - with SFE Client Amy
Episode Description
A very talented athlete, Amy has been an SFE member for a number of years now. After navigating a number of setbacks during this time, she has successfully built herself back up to to being able to take on the Lakeland 100 this year, shaving an impressive 8+ hours off her previous attempt.
Listen in to this emotional but inspiring story, that many of you will relate to - navigating the highs and lows of endurance sport, injury, and ultimately coming out the other side stronger, smarter and ready to take on more in the future.
